I was given 2 tanks.. they are very small only about 3 gallons each and they hang on the wall. They have a submersible filter.

I have a 55 gallon freshwater community tank and a 75 gallon fresswater cichlid tank. I was thinking about stepping out of the box a little. Maybe a small saltwater in one and experimenting with live plants in the other...?

Anybody have and tips? I have never dealt with a tank this small and don't really know what kind of fish are suited for it. Oh, and I do not want goldfish or guppies.. at all.

if you wanted to do a saltwater 3 gallon i would recommend some live rock, a couple good looking coral, one starfish or a crab and one other fish. a three gallon can't support much marine life at all. you can make it look great, but you won't see much movement.
